Tripura government launches portal to support businesses hit by the second wave of COVID-19

The Tripura government on Monday launched an online portal for supporting businesses that were impacted by the coronavirus outbreak. Chief Minister Biplab Kumar Deb took to Twitter to make the announcement about the online portal, dubbed as Jagrut Tripura, which would help pandemic-hit businesses with loan needs and other requirements.

“Our Government under PM Shri @narendramodi ji’s leadership are committed to supporting our people as we continue to recover from COVID,” CM Biplab Kumar Deb tweeted along with the announcement on Jagrut Tripura portal.

The portal asks visitors to log in with their details such as their age, location, gender, religion, academic qualifications, economic status and area of residence. The portal houses a total of 109 schemes that are broadly grouped into various categories: Education (43), Small Business/Employment (16), Agriculture (14), Pension (12), Health and Medical (10), Housing (7), Social Services (6) and Fisheries (1).

US President Joe Biden approves $735 million weapons sales to Israel amidst tensions with Palestine

As violence between Israel and the terrorist group Hamas escalates, American President Joe Biden has approved the sale of $735 million in precision-guided weapons to Israel.

According to a report published in the Washington Post, a major part of the proposed sale is of Joint Direct Attack Munitions, or JDAMS, kits that transform so-called “dumb” bombs into precision-guided missiles. Israel, which has bought a great many numbers of JDAMS from the US in the past, has said that it has been using precision-guided missiles to attack Hamas hideouts in Gaza to avoid civilian casualties.

The Congress was officially notified of the proposed sale on May 5, days before the tensions between Israel and Palestine spiralled into a full-fledged war, with Hamas terror outfit launching rockets towards Israel and the Jewish Nation retaliating back with even more ferocity. So far, about 200 Palestinians and 10 Israelis have died in the crisis that has been worse since the 2014 Hamas-Israeli war that lasted nearly two months.

As per US laws, the incumbent government is required to inform Congress of such sales, although official notification usually comes after Congress has informally agreed. Once the formal notification is made as in this case, the legislators have 20 days to object with a non-binding resolution of disapproval.

The weapons sale by the Joe Biden administration is likely to attract opposition from at least some members within his party who have been vocal in their support for Palestine.

Turkey President Erdogan seeks Christian support for sanctions against Israel, calls Pope Francis

President of Turkey Recep Tayyip Erdogan has spoken with Pope Francis over the violence in Gaza and has urged the head of the Catholic Church to support sanctions against Israel. The revelation was made in a statement on social media by the Presidency of Turkey.

During the call, Erdogan emphasised that “Israel’s attacks concerned not only the Palestinians but all the Muslims, all the Christians and the entire humanity.”

Statement by the Turkish Presidency

The Turkish President highlighted the recent clashes at the Al-Aqsa Mosque to claim that Israel’s actions threatened regional peace. He also said that access to the Church of the Holy Sepulchre was also blocked. Significantly, Erdogan sought Christian support for sanctions against Israel.

The statement said, “Further stressing that the Palestinians would continue to be massacred unless the international community punished Israel, which had been committing a crime against humanity, with due sanctions, President Erdogan highlighted the great importance of the messages and reactions Pope Francis would continue to give in terms of mobilizing the Christian world and the international community.”

Erdogan also took subtle jibes at the Joe Biden administration after the USA blocked a joint statement by the UN Security Council urging ceasefire three times in a week.

The statement said, “Pointing out that the international community should give Israel the deterrent reaction and lesson it deserved and take concrete steps to that end, President Erdogan stated that Turkey devoted all its efforts to that aim and was carrying out intensive diplomacy efforts in all relevant international platforms, the United Nations in particular, but that the Security Council had yet to display the required awareness of responsibility.”

Violence has continued to rock the region as the Israel-Palestine conflict continues unabated. India has condemned the spate of violence at both ends and has called for immediate de-escalation.
